Vanilla Extract vs Panda CSS: Complete Comparison Guide 2026
Last updated: March 2026 | Category: CSS Frameworks | Javascript Ecosystem
This FAQ covers the most common questions developers ask when choosing between Vanilla Extract and Panda CSS. Both are popular tools for css frameworks in Javascript development.
Quick Comparison
| Aspect | Vanilla Extract | Panda CSS |
|---|---|---|
| Category | CSS Frameworks | CSS Frameworks |
| Ecosystem | Javascript | Javascript |
| Maturity | Established | Modern |
| Skills | View CBFDAE | View CBFDAE |
Frequently Asked Questions
What is the difference between Vanilla Extract and Panda CSS?
Vanilla Extract and Panda CSS are both popular tools in the CSS Frameworks category for Javascript development. Vanilla Extract emphasizes a battle-tested ecosystem with extensive community support and plugins, while Panda CSS focuses on modern developer experience, performance optimizations, and simpler APIs. The right choice depends on your project requirements, team experience, and scale. Explore their full CBFDAE architecture patterns on the FastBuilder.AI Skills Registry.
Which is better for production: Vanilla Extract or Panda CSS?
Both are production-ready. Vanilla Extract has a longer track record with proven scalability at companies of all sizes. Panda CSS has been gaining rapid adoption with strong performance benchmarks. For enterprise teams with existing Vanilla Extract expertise, sticking with Vanilla Extract reduces risk. For greenfield projects prioritizing performance and DX, Panda CSS is an excellent choice.
Is Vanilla Extract faster than Panda CSS?
Performance depends on the specific use case. Panda CSS may have faster startup times and smaller bundle sizes in certain benchmarks, while Vanilla Extract often excels in sustained throughput for complex applications. Always benchmark with your actual workload before deciding. FastBuilder.AI's CBFDAE analysis can help you understand the architectural performance characteristics of each.
Can I use Vanilla Extract and Panda CSS together?
In most cases, Vanilla Extract and Panda CSS serve similar purposes and using both adds unnecessary complexity. However, some projects use them in complementary ways — for example, migrating from Vanilla Extract to Panda CSS gradually. Check the compatibility notes and migration guides in each project's documentation.
Which has better community support: Vanilla Extract or Panda CSS?
Both have active communities. Vanilla Extract typically has more Stack Overflow answers, tutorials, and third-party packages due to its longer history. Panda CSS's community is growing rapidly with active Discord servers and regular releases. Evaluate the quality and responsiveness of each community for your specific needs.
What are the main advantages of Vanilla Extract?
Vanilla Extract offers a mature ecosystem, extensive documentation, large talent pool, battle-tested reliability, and broad integration support. It's a safe choice for teams that value stability and long-term maintainability.
What are the main advantages of Panda CSS?
Panda CSS provides modern APIs, excellent performance, smaller bundle sizes, innovative features, and a focus on developer experience. It's ideal for teams building new projects with cutting-edge requirements.
How do I choose between Vanilla Extract and Panda CSS for my project?
Consider: (1) Does your team have existing expertise with either? (2) What are your performance requirements? (3) Do you need specific ecosystem integrations? (4) Is long-term stability or innovation more important? Use FastBuilder.AI's CBFDAE architecture analysis to compare their structural patterns side by side.